温馨提示:这篇文章已超过287天没有更新,请注意相关的内容是否还可用!
a标签和div标签都是HTML中常用的标签,用于创建超链接和布局网页结构。
a标签用于创建超链接,可以将文本或图像转化为可点击的链接,使用户能够跳转到其他页面或下载文件。a标签的基本语法如下:
<a href="链接地址">链接文本</a>
其中,`href`属性指定了链接的目标地址,可以是其他网页的URL,也可以是文件的URL。例如,下面的代码创建了一个指向百度搜索首页的链接:
<a href="https://www.baidu.com">百度搜索</a>
除了指定链接的目标地址,a标签还可以通过`target`属性指定链接在何处打开。常用的取值有:
- `_blank`:在新窗口或新标签页中打开链接;
- `_self`:在当前窗口或标签页中打开链接(默认值);
- `_parent`:在父窗口或父框架中打开链接;
- `_top`:在整个窗口中打开链接,忽略所有框架。
例如,下面的代码将在新标签页中打开百度搜索:
<a href="https://www.baidu.com" target="_blank">百度搜索</a>
div标签用于创建块级元素,用于组织和布局网页中的内容。div标签没有特定的语义,可以根据需要自由地定义样式和布局。div标签的基本语法如下:
<div>内容</div>
例如,下面的代码创建了一个包含文本内容的div:
<div>这是一个div</div>
div标签常用于创建网页的布局结构,通过设置div的样式属性,可以实现各种复杂的布局效果。例如,下面的代码使用div标签创建了一个简单的网页布局:
<style>
.container {
display: flex;
justify-content: space-between;
}
</style>
<div class="c4ae-c0d5-1841-3a56 container">
<div>左侧内容</div>
<div>右侧内容</div>
</div>
在上述代码中,使用了CSS的flex布局,通过设置`.container`的样式属性,将两个div元素水平排列,并且两者之间有间隔。
除了使用div标签,还可以使用其他标签实现类似的布局效果。例如,使用`span`标签可以实现行内元素的布局,使用`section`标签可以实现更语义化的内容分块。
a标签用于创建超链接,div标签用于布局网页结构。通过设置a标签的`href`属性和div标签的样式属性,可以实现丰富多样的链接和布局效果。在实际开发中,可以根据具体需求选择合适的标签和属性,以达到最佳的用户体验和代码可维护性。